A105N ball valve is specifically designed for low-temperature applications, with its core feature being the ability to operate in extremely low-temperature environments (typically ranging from -40°C to -196°C), ensuring normal opening/closing, reliable sealing, and structural stability under cryogenic conditions.
The imported low-temperature steel ball valve controls the flow of media by rotating the ball 90°. When the ball's channel aligns with the valve body, the media flows; when rotated to a perpendicular position, the media is cut off. Its core features include:
Low-Temperature Adaptability: Made from special steels (such as LCB, LC3, CF8, etc.) and processed with cryogenic treatment to prevent brittle fracture or deformation of the material at low temperatures.
Sealing Performance: The ball and valve seat are precision-ground to fit, combined with a spring-loaded redundant sealing structure (e.g., soft seat + fire-safe seat), achieving bidirectional zero leakage.
Corrosion Resistance: The valve body material (e.g., 304/316 stainless steel) and sealing materials (e.g., PTFE, PCTFE) offer excellent corrosion resistance, making them suitable for various corrosive media.

Tests Of API 6D
API 6D specifies the following tests:
Stem backseat test
Pressure at 1.1 times valve rating for 2 to 5 minutes depending on valve size
No visible leakage
Hydrostatic shell test
Pressure at 1.5 times valve rating for 2 to 30 minutes depending on valve size
No visible leakage
Hydrostatic seat test
Pressure at 1.1 times valve rating for 2 to 5 minutes depending on valve size
Soft-seated valves: No visible leakage
Metal-seated valves: Leakage not more than two times ISO 5208 Rate D
